1.0 ,2.0,5.5,11.0,to 18.0 mbps

my laptop runs at 54.0 mega bits per second, just a few days ago it dropped to one i adjusted the router and now it varies between the title, i got right next to the router in my grandmas room and it said 54.0 mega bits per second, when i backed up into to my room the signal dropped a lot its not very far nothings in the way of it,i turned off the modem then the router i turned the modem on first then the the router, i cant get any signal for my ps3 i doesn't reach to my ps3 i am at 18.0 mega bits per second at the moment.

Re: 1.0 ,2.0,5.5,11.0,to 18.0 mbps

It is the wireless in the router that appears to be the issue. Reset to factory defaults after writing down the wan settings then reconfigure. See if there is a firmware update for the unit. Otherwise plan on replacing it.
